    Pau (the drummer) sings when she exercises including when she runs. She does it for conditioning and practicing her voice control. As others say in comments, she had been doing this for as long as she has been playing drums. People who don't perform live may not understand the amount of mental coordination required to sing while playing an instrument and I believe playing drums while singing is by far the most exhausting. Pau makes it look easy, but there is a good reason she isn't the lead singer on every song. Most of the time Pau and Dany (guitarist) trade vocals, as in this song, or Pau backs up Dany. She does sing lead on several songs, though, usually ballads. She had a raspy, soulful, emotional voice that can bring you to tears. Ale (bassist) sings low or high harmonies, as the song requires. She has a wonderful voice but her vocal range is not as wide as Dany's and she doesn't enjoy singing the lead parts. Again, it is a challenge that people who have never attempted it may not understand. Playing bass and singing lead is a skill you must learn because in most cases you are playing completely different notes or at least playing the notes in a lower octave (bass clef) while singing in the treble clef. BTW they are bilingual and easily transition between Spanish, their primary language, and English. They also know a smattering of French, though I believe Pau may be the only one who can carry on a conversation in the language.

    Dany is the Blonde Paul is the Drummer and Ale is the bass. 3 Sisters and English is not their first Language. Pau's first Drummer teacher taught her how to sing along with the drumming. They got their Start by their Dad buying Rock Band Video Games. That started them. They did a cover very young of Enter Sandman and it went viral on Face Book. Dad recorded it and put it on YT for the grandparents to watch. 7 million views over night. Ellen had them on and Target sent them to Berkley Music College.     This presentation at the "Teatro Metropolitan de la CDMX" (both dates) was the first time they had a light show specially designed for each of their songs. They were able to do it in the capital of our country (I'm also Mexican), but they still can't do it in other places.
    They're still a relatively small band, so during the tour they're doing right now across the US, except for festivals, they mostly play to auditoriums of 600 to 1,000 people using the lighting fixtures in the venue, because they still can't afford a custom light show in each venue, nor do they risk performing in much larger venues because they consider that few people even know their music.
    This isn't all bad, because it allows the audience to come into closer contact with the band and get to know their capabilities without being influenced by the glare of some pretty lights.
